Day by day

Day 1: Longyearbyen and Departure into the Arctic
The expedition starts at Longyearbyen which stands as a tiny settlement between Spitsbergen's wild natural environment. The northern settlement functions as Svalbard's entrance to its distant wilderness areas. The expedition vessel boarding process creates excitement which builds toward the upcoming journey. The ship sails past the port to show us the wild coastal rocks before we enter the vast Arctic sea. The polar summer brings extended daylight which produces a special illumination that enables travelers to experience the rugged beauty of this area during their initial voyage.
Day 2: Fjords and First Arctic Exploration
The second day introduces you to Svalbard’s iconic fjords, where steep mountains rise above icy waters. The expedition team operates through a flexible system which adapts their activities to current conditions during their exploration work. You may step into a Zodiac for a closer look at glacier fronts or set foot on land to experience the tundra environment. The wildlife population increases because seals spend their time on ice while seabirds establish their nests on cliff faces. The Arctic nature reveals solitude because its extensive land area stretches into the distance.
